#e8858c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#e8858c is composed of 91% red, 52.2% green and 54.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 42.7% magenta, 39.7% yellow and 9% black. It has a hue angle of 355.8 degrees, a saturation of 68.3% and a lightness of 71.6%. #e8858c color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#d10b19. Closest websafe color is: #ff9999.

#e8858c color description : Very soft red.

#e8858c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#e8858c has RGB values of R:232, G:133, B:140 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.43, Y:0.4, K:0.09. Its decimal value is 15238540.

Shades and Tints of #e8858c

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0a0202 is the darkest color, while #fef9f9 is the lightest one.

Tones of #e8858c

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#bbb2b2 is the less saturated color, while #fe6f79 is the most saturated one.
